> >> > Some earlier relevant  feedback:
> >> >
> >> > I thought of most  likely Senecio barbertonicus ..BUT its flower head
> >> > usually  has branches and many flowers on one stalk of flower
> >> > Your plant has one  flower per stalk...
> >> > please run a key and find it and share with us...clue is the daisy
> like
> >> > flower
> >> > my guess right now is* senecio scaposus*
> >> > usha di
> >> >
> >> > Senecio scaposus may be correct ID. Ushadi this species has often 3-5
> >> heads
> >> > at the tip of scape. I can count 2 in one, 3-4 in another.- from Singh
> >> ji.
